In 1512, the Portuguese established its trade link in Indonesia. They introduced Roman Catholicism, remaining few vocabularies that keep on being inside the national language “Bahasa Indonesia” and native dialects spoken during the Spice Islands of Maluku, and these notably experienced political and cultural importance in East Timor or Timor Leste, which was Component of Indonesia from 1976 to 1999. Yet it's the Dutch who proven the Roman-Dutch civil legislation legal program to facilitate its trade and political-financial curiosity. This era of 350 several years is comprised of a period of unique trade by a company using a maritime power; the Dutch East India Enterprise, or Vereenigde Oost-Indische Compagnie (VOC) commencing in 1596, and also a period of official colonization via the Dutch starting up in early 1800. While in the latter time period, Indonesia was called the Netherlands East Indies. It ought to be famous nevertheless, which the Dutch didn't dominate The full archipelago suddenly, but instead after some time. Their longest existence of three and also a 50 % century was on Jawa Island. Aceh, On the flip side, is Amongst the shortest. Resistance from community kingdoms and communities were the strongest aspect. The British ruled for a brief interval from 1811-1816 but didn't make sizeable modifications to the prevailing lawful process for this intent. Facing the diversities of Indonesians, the Dutch popularized the usage of Malay language through Indonesia. This language afterwards evolved into “Bahasa Indonesia.” Roman script was employed as the official composing program. The Dutch didn't contend with or govern the Indonesians right, but through the aristocrats along with the oriental settlers. Accordingly, populace was divided into a few courses: the Europeans to whom codified civil legislation was relevant, the overseas Orientals to whom Section of civil regulation program managed, plus the indigenous to which Adat legislation and Islamic legislation policies used.

eighteen/2003 on Advocates dated five April 2003 (“Law 18/2003”) and Governing administration Regulation No. 83/2008 on Requirements and Techniques for Provision of Totally free Legal Aid dated 31 December 2008 (“GR 83/2008”), delegates the obligation to advocates to supply gratis (pro bono) lawful assistance to incapable justice seekers. To facilitate the provision of professional bono lawful assistance more efficiently and efficiently, PERADI as being the advocacy organization has fashioned a Office known as Authorized Assist Centre (“PBH PERADI”) within the Group to equip its mission to assist individuals who seek out for authorized support. PBH PERADI could appoint an Advocate to deliver Professional bono legal guidance to incapable justice seekers, this applies equally to any software or ask for directly from incapable justice seekers. Other than being an obligation, offering pro bono legal support is also carried out on the initiative of the advocate alone to be a form of devotion for the Neighborhood. PERADI Rule No. 1/2010 stipulates that advocate are advised to supply pro bono lawful support a minimum of 50 hours of labor each year. This provision will likely be employed as one among the requirements to get or to renew the Advocate Identification Card (“KTPA”) and when advocates couldn't satisfy this necessity, then the KTPA issuance will likely be deferred until this prerequisite is fulfilled.
